Groby is a village located in Leicestershire, England, with GPS coordinates of 52.65915, -1.22356. It lies approximately five miles northwest of the city of Leicester. Groby is situated in the Europe/London timezone, which follows UTC+0 during standard time and UTC+1 during daylight saving time.
The village is known for its picturesque countryside and community-oriented atmosphere. Groby also features several historical buildings, including St. Philip and St.
James Church, which contributes to its local charm. Its proximity to Leicester provides residents and visitors access to urban amenities while enjoying a more tranquil village lifestyle. Groby serves as a residential area, offering a blend of suburban living and natural beauty, making it a notable part of the Leicestershire region.
Timezone in Groby
Groby is situated in the Europe/London timezone, which operates on a UTC offset of +0 during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, which typically runs from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the offset changes to UTC +1. This adjustment means that clocks in Groby spring forward by one hour in the spring and fall back in autumn.
When considering contact with Groby from the United States, the time difference can vary significantly depending on the U.S. location. For instance, New York is usually five hours behind Groby during standard time and four hours behind during daylight saving time, while Los Angeles can be eight hours behind during standard time and seven hours behind during daylight saving time. Therefore, it is best to contact someone in Groby between 9 AM and 5 PM local time, which corresponds to 4 AM to 12 PM in New York and 1 AM to 9 AM in Los Angeles.
In comparison to other major cities in the region, such as Birmingham and Leicester, Groby shares the same timezone and daylight saving time practices. This uniformity makes coordination simpler for residents and businesses alike, ensuring consistent scheduling across the region.
Attractions and Activities in Groby
Groby is a village located in Leicestershire, England, known for its suburban character and close-knit community. It is situated just a few miles northwest of the city of Leicester, which contributes to its appeal as a residential area. The village features a mix of historical and modern elements, with several local parks and green spaces that offer residents and visitors a chance to enjoy nature.
The nearby Bradgate Park, famous for its deer and stunning landscapes, is a significant attraction that draws people from surrounding areas. Groby also has a rich historical background, with remnants of its past evident in local architecture and landmarks. The village is home to St.
Philip and St. James Church, a notable structure that reflects the area’s ecclesiastical heritage. While Groby may not be a major tourist destination, it is well-known for its community spirit and local events, including village fairs and seasonal celebrations, which enhance the cultural fabric of the area.
Overall, Groby embodies the charm of a traditional English village while benefiting from its proximity to larger urban centers.
Practical Information for Visitors
Groby is located near Leicester in the East Midlands of England, making it accessible via various transport options. The nearest major airport is East Midlands Airport, about 20 miles away, offering both domestic and international flights. For train travel, the Groby area is well-connected by the local bus services from Leicester, which also has a direct train line to other major cities.
The weather in Groby tends to be typical of the UK, characterized by mild summers and cool winters. Average temperatures range from 2°C in winter to about 20°C in summer. The best time to visit is between late spring and early autumn, when the weather is generally warmer and drier, allowing for enjoyable outdoor activities.
Visitors should consider wearing comfortable shoes for walking, as Groby has lovely parks and nature trails. It’s also advisable to check local events beforehand, as the community often hosts fairs and festivals that provide a great opportunity to experience local culture. Always pack a light rain jacket, as showers can occur unexpectedly, even in summer.
